Understanding Limited Liability Companies
LLCs, or LLCs, are a frequently selected type of business entity in the US due to their flexibility and asset protection qualities. An LLC combines the benefits of a company and a collaborative entity, allowing proprietors, known as owners, to protect their individual belongings from business liabilities. This means that in the situation of legal actions or debts, members are typically not individually accountable for the company's debt, providing them confidence while running their ventures.
Each state has its unique criteria for establishing and sustaining an LLC, which can lead to differences in rules and tax obligations. For instance, a Texas LLC lookup may result in different information and specifications compared to a Florida LLC lookup or a Wyoming LLC inquiry. Grasping these variations is vital for business owners who wish to set up their businesses in a particular state, as they must comply with state laws, such as application fees and regular adherence.
When going through the steps of creating an LLC, it is important to conduct thorough research, including a US state LLC search, to obtain all necessary data regarding the naming options, application processes, and regulations specific to the chosen state. Doing so not only helps in adhering to legal requirements but also ensures that the entity is created on a solid foundation from the very start.

FL LLC Inquiry Procedure
Performing a Florida Limited Liability Company inquiry is an essential aspect for people seeking to form or verify a limited liability company in the state. The State of Florida's Department of State provides an online database that enables users to quickly access information about registered Limited Liability Companies. To start the process, individuals can go to the Corporations Division site and navigate to the "Search Our Records" section. Inputting either the name of the Limited Liability Company or the registration number will yield results that contain the company’s standing, filing dates, and agent information.
Once the search results are shown, you can inspect detailed information for each LLC. This includes not only the entity’s standing but also its main office location, the names of its owners or managers, and any associated documents. Understanding this information is vital for potential business owners, as it provides insights into the company's validity and adherence with state laws. If required, users can obtain copies of documents for additional review.
For those seeking to form a new LLC, doing a name inquiry is especially vital to verify that the desired business name is accessible. The guidelines set by the Florida mandate that each Limited Liability Company title must be distinct and not deceptively similar to current entities. By utilizing the Florida LLC lookup procedure, entrepreneurs can avoid potential legal issues and can easily navigate the business formation environment in Florida.
The state of Wyoming Limited Liability Company Inquiry Insights
This state is recognized for its entrepreneur-friendly environment, making it a favored choice for startups looking to establish LLCs. small business LLC database is simple and delivers essential information about registered businesses. By utilizing the Wyoming's business entity search tool, users can quickly access details such as the business’ formation date, its registered agents, and its current standing. This openness is vital for people seeking to create trust and conduct business with firms in the state.
One notable benefit of searching for LLCs in this state is the level of confidentiality offered to business owners. In contrast to some other states, Wyoming does not typically require the disclosure of member names in public records. This characteristic appeals to many investors who prioritize anonymity while still ensuring their businesses adhere to state laws. Conducting a Wyoming LLC search allows potential partners and clients to verify a business's credibility without jeopardizing the privacy of its owners.
Furthermore, the search results may reveal significant information regarding any filings or legal actions that may impact an LLC. This can include specifics about annual reports, changes in registered agents, or even situations of dissolution. By executing a comprehensive Wyoming LLC search, business owners and investors can gather insights and lessen risks linked to potential partnerships.
